Title: Masahiko Natsume: Innovator in Radiator Cleaning Technology
Introduction
Masahiko Natsume is a notable inventor based in Wako, Japan. He has made significant contributions to the field of automotive technology, particularly in the area of radiator cleaning methods. His innovative approach has the potential to enhance vehicle maintenance and efficiency.
Latest Patents
Natsume holds a patent for a "Radiator cleaning treatment method and method for cleaning radiator." This method involves a unique process for cleaning a vehicle's radiator, which includes stopping the vehicle that contains a fuel cell through which coolant passes. During this process, electric power is generated in the fuel cell to raise the temperature of the coolant while the vehicle is stationary. The coolant is then circulated from the fuel cell to the radiator, and the coolant flowing from the radiator is supplied to an ion exchanger to remove ions from the coolant, all while the vehicle is not in motion.
